Implemented Device/Service discovery with incremented timeout values.
BluetoothTaskManagerWin::StartDiscovery() calls BluetoothTaskManagerWin::DiscoverDevices() with timeout = 1. DiscoverDevices() then issues a device inquiry for timeout period, then posts another DiscoverDevices() with timeout+1. DiscoverDevices() stops posting itself when StopDiscovery() is called, or timeout reaches maximum (48). + // Starts discovery. Once the discovery starts, it issues a discovery inquiry
+ // with a short timeout, then issues more inquiries with greater timeout
+ // values. The discovery finishes when StopDiscovery() is called or timeout
+ // has reached its maximum value.
+ void StartDiscovery();
+ void StopDiscovery();
+
+ // Issues a device inquiry that runs for |timeout| * 1.28 seconds.
+ // This posts itself again with |timeout| + 1 until |timeout| reaches the
+ // maximum value or stop discovery call is received.
+ void DiscoverDevices(int timeout);
+
+ // Fetch already known device information. Similar to |StartDiscovery|, except
+ // this function does not issue a discovery inquiry. Instead it gets the
+ // device info cached in the adapter.
+ void GetKnownDevices();
+
+ // Sends a device search API call to the adapter.
+ void SearchDevices(int timeout,
+ bool search_cached_devices_only,
+ ScopedVector<DeviceState>* device_list);
+
+ // Discover services for the devices in |device_list|.
+ void DiscoverServices(ScopedVector<DeviceState>* device_list);
